Los Angeles Dodgers outfielder
Mookie Betts won his sixth career Silver Slugger award in 2023 by hitting .307/.408/.579, his best marks in each category since he won the 2018 American League MVP, and he also had a career-high 39 home runs. Betts had 80 extra-base hits for the second time in his career and led all position players (aside from
Shohei Ohtani) with an 8.3 bWAR. The other Silver Slugger award-winners in the National League were Braves first baseman
Matt Olson, Marlins second baseman
Luis Arraez, Mets shortstop
Francisco Lindor, Braves third baseman
Austin Riley, Braves outfielder
Ronald Acuna Jr., Padres outfielder
Juan Soto, Brewers catcher
William Contreras, Phillies DH
Bryce Harper and Cubs utility man
Cody Bellinger.
